James Weaver Music Jr. age 74,of Jacksonville, Fl., went to Heaven July 23rd 2021 surrounded by his children and his wife Marie. James was born in Oak Ridge, Tennessee, grew up in Daytona, Fl. and resided in Jacksonville, Fl. His parents James and Thelma Music Sr. preceded him in death. He is survived by the love of his life for 55 years , Marie L. Music and his three daughters Lisa Beadle, Barbara Griffin, Michelle Aspinwall and his dog Coco Channel. He is also survived by his brother John Music and his two sisters April Sears and Cheryl Hutchinson. James has 8 grandchildren Kayla, Tatum, Hunter Beadle, Chelsea and Matt Griffin, Breana (Nugent), Ryan and Rylee James Aspinwall and several great grandchildren, great nieces and great nephews.
James graduated from Florida State College with an AA degree. He began working at the young age of 7 helping his father with painting and small carpenter jobs. He proudly served in the US Marine Corps from July 1964 to August 1967 which included a tour of Vietnam. He received an Honorable Discharged in August 1967. James worked 46 years in the steel industry retiring August 8, 2013. James was a faithful member of the Church of Suncoast. He also volunteered in the community coaching children in softball and gymnastics.
James Music Jr. was a people-person and had a special gift that would make everyone he talked with feel like they were the most important person around. He never missed a moment to witness the Word of God and no matter what he was going through would remain a shinning light. James was a hardworking family man who could out-work anyone all the while making the task fun! James loved to hunt and took care of his family and anyone in need. He will truly be missed but never forgotten.
He is the “Rock“ of our family and his light will continue to shine down all of us.
